.curve-wrapper{width:100%;height:140px;position:absolute;-webkit-transform:translateX(-50%);-ms-transform:translateX(-50%);transform:translateX(-50%);left:50%;z-index:9;margin-top:-140px;margin-left:-1px;display:none;overflow:hidden;max-width:100vw}.curve-wrapper svg{width:100%;height:100%;min-width:1600px;position:absolute;left:50%;-webkit-transform:translateX(-50%);-ms-transform:translateX(-50%);transform:translateX(-50%)}@media (min-width:0px) and (max-width:575px){.curve-wrapper svg{min-width:600px}}@media (min-width:0px) and (max-width:575px){.curve-wrapper{height:60px;margin-top:-60px}}.home-section--homelink .curve-wrapper{margin-top:-220px}@media (min-width:992px) and (max-width:1199px){.home-section--homelink .curve-wrapper{margin-top:-200px}}@media (min-width:576px) and (max-width:767px){.home-section--homelink .curve-wrapper{margin-top:-170px}}@media (min-width:768px) and (max-width:991px){.home-section--homelink .curve-wrapper{margin-top:-170px}}@media (min-width:0px) and (max-width:575px){.home-section--homelink .curve-wrapper{margin-top:-90px}}.home-section--homelink .curve-wrapper__bg{display:none}.home-section--event{padding-bottom:180px!important}@media (min-width:0px) and (max-width:575px){.home-section--event{padding-bottom:70px!important}}.home-section--banners .banners__item{padding-bottom:75px}@media (min-width:0px) and (max-width:575px){.home-section--banners .banners__item{padding-bottom:0}}.home-section--event+.home-section--homelink .curve-wrapper{display:block}main>.curve-wrapper{display:block}.pre-footer .curve-wrapper{margin-top:-175px;display:block}@media (min-width:0px) and (max-width:575px){.pre-footer .curve-wrapper{margin-top:-100px}}.pre-footer .curve-wrapper path{fill:var(--primary-colour)}